Photo taken in Jan , 07 - At a local Synagog.Today is Yom - Kipur according to our tradition...we ask forgiveness from every one we know...friends or family...May we all forgive one another,if we in any way ,or just in case hurt each other.Some of us will fast this holy sacred day..religious and even non religious...As a Jewish non - religious myself, I chose to fast myself in this significant day.Cars are not allow to drive in Israel, unless a very serious health problem during this day. Of course no one work on this day...only emergency .Thanks for viewing and commenting...Shana Tova and Gmar Hatima Tova...Tsom kal, lemi shetsam. Copyrights myself.
